Once Lice Choice Head Lice Treatment Spray has … Webb12 sep. 2024 · Do not share combs, brushes, or towels. Disinfest combs and brushes used by an infested person by soaking them in hot water (at least 130°F) for 5–10 minutes. Do not lie on beds, couches, pillows, carpets, or stuffed animals that have recently been in contact with an infested person.

Repeat the shampoo about a week after … WebbThe "no nit" policy assumes that all nits seen when examining the scalp are viable and therefore the infested individual should be treated for lice, and all nits must be removed from the scalp. However, it has been repeatedly shown that only a small number of children who have nits on their scalp are also infested with living lice. easycord pressing calor

WebbHead lice are mainly acquired through direct head-to-head contact with an infested person’s hair. Objects such as combs, hats, brushes, or helmets rarely harbor or transmit head lice or their eggs (nits), but it may occur under certain circumstances, so cleaning of items is recommended.
